        When it comes to religion, having faith is one of the fundamentals.

        Faith is, according to Oxford, a “strong belief in God or in the doctrines of a religion, based on spiritual apprehension rather than proof.”
        Though there isn’t something right before your eyes giving you proof that there is a God, that doesn’t necessarily mean there isn’t one.

        For example, there isn’t concrete evidence alien life exists, but many people agree it is possible on some other far-off planet or moon for it to exist or have existed, even if just in the microscopic level. Scientists point towards probabilities and exoplanets in other solar systems within their star’s habitable zone. This is the same way people of a religion point towards their religious writings, events in history, and other phenomena in the world. There are some people who say “I need to see it to believe it” while others have faith in their beliefs. That’s ultimately the difference between those who are religious and non-religious.
